Case Presentation: A 43‐year‐old woman presented with acute pleuritic chest pain and shortness of breath. She had no medical history or medications besides day 6 of 7 of nitrofurantoin for UTI. She had had a 4‐hour flight earlier in the day and noted dyspnea when using stairs at home. She went to sleep and woke […]

Background: The hospital discharge process is challenging and opportune for human error. Medication discrepancies continue to be a patient-safety problem, exacerbated with the multiple sources of discharge medication documentation. Medication discrepancies may lead to medication errors and may contribute to adverse drug events with potential subsequent healthcare utilization and cost. Discharge medications can be listed […]
